At the start of the basketball game, the referee tosses a ball for a jump ball. The equation that models the height of the ball is h(t) = -16t2 + 24t + 5 During what time interval is the height of the ball above 9 feet? (Round your answer to the nearest tenth of a second.) a) .6 seconds to 1.8 seconds b) .4 seconds to 1.9 seconds c) .2 seconds to 1.3 seconds d) .5 seconds to 2.1 seconds

OpenStudy (phi):

can you find the time(s) when h(t)=9 ? \[ 9= -16t^2+24t+5 \]

OpenStudy (phi):

I would use the quadratic formula t= (-b ± sqrt(b^2 -4ac))/2a
